OLC Signs on as Partner in Ohio Opioid Education Alliance

At its meeting on Fri., Sept. 14, the OLC Board of Directors unanimously approved the OLC’s participation as a partner in the Ohio Opioid Education Alliance. The Alliance is composed of more than 30 Ohio businesses, universities, non-profit organizations, and trade and professional associations that are committed to supporting the effort to educate Ohioans about the dangers of opioid addiction and the impact it’s having on communities throughout the state. The Ohio Opioid Education Alliance is currently underwritten by the Nationwide Insurance Foundation.

 

As an official Alliance partner, the OLC will encourage its member libraries to share information with their staffs and the 8.5 million public library cardholders in Ohio that they serve. Within the coming weeks, the OLC will provide guidance on how libraries can implement the awareness/education campaign, including the use of materials that are based on the fictional town of Denial, Ohio.
